Ingredients

  • 1 Pineapple ripe
  • half inch fresh ginger/ grated you can skip it if you don't like ginger
  • cup raw honey/ use your choice of sweetener for vegan version
  • 1 lime juice - Natural Peticin

Instructions

  • Start by making an even-as-you-can cut across the top, to remove it. As you can see in the video
  • Place the hollow part of the pineapple corer over the core.
  • Once in place, begin turning clockwise while pushing down until you get to the bottom of the pineapple
  • Once in place, begin turning clockwise while pushing down until you get to the bottom of the pineapple
  • Grip the handle and press the black buttons (there’s one on either side) and pull up.
  • Add the pineapple rings in the Instant pot . Add the grated ginger, lime juice and honey .
  • Close the lid and turn the valve in a Sealing position. Press the "Pressure Cook" or "Manual" button and set the time for 10 minutes on High pressure.
  • When its done , quick release the steam. Open the lid and use a high speed immersion blender to make a puree
  • Press the Saute button on the Instant Pot and let the pineapple jam cook and thicken . Keep stirring, until thickened to your desired consistency it will take about 10 minutes

Video

Notes

  • If you do not have a immersion blender make pineapple puree and then add it in the instant pot (add pineapple chunks/ rings in a food processor and process for several minutes until smooth.)
  • Make sure the pineapple is ripe
